Outcomes of Adjunctive Balloon Post-dilation in Proximal Area comprising Angiographically Normal Segment to Underexpanded Proximal Portion of the Implanted Stent
고려대학교 구로병원 순환기내과
나승운, Yoshiyasu Minami, Zhe Jin, Kang-Yin Chen, Yong-Jian Li, Kanhaiya L. Poddar, 박재형, 나진오, 최철웅, 임홍의, 김진원, 김응주, 박창규, 서홍석, 오동주
Background: Adjunctive balloon post-dilation (ABP) using compliant stent delivery balloon in the proximal area comprising angiographically normal native coronary artery segment to the underexpanded proximal portion of the implanted stent may be a cost-effective strategy compared with traditional ABP using new larger non-compliant short balloon. We investigated whether there are acute procedural complications such as intimal dissection or thrombosis and subsequent adverse clinical outcomes due to the balloon injury up to 6 months. Methods: A total 71 out of 1126 patients (6.3%) who underwent percutaneous coronary intervention (PCI) with drug-eluting stents (DES) showed stent underexpansion received ABP with higher pressure than nominal pressure using stent delivery balloon for further stent expansion. We compared the in-hospital and 6-month clinical outcomes of the proximal balloon group to those of no proximal balloon group. Results: Baseline clinical and procedural characteristics were similar between the two groups. There were no significant differences in acute procedure-related complications and in-hospital clinical outcomes between the two groups. We failed to find the any differences in terms of adverse short-term and mid-term clinical outcomes between Proximal Balloon group and No Proximal Balloon group (total MACEs 2.6% vs. 2.8%, p=0.71). Conclusions: ABP using stent delivery balloon in the proximal area comprising angiographically normal native coronary artery segment to the underexpanded proximal portion of the implanted stent can be a cost-effective strategy in selective patients.
